## Key Ceremony Checklist — Item 14: Deep-Link Routing

Quick one for the support crew: before we seal the signing keys for the Hoppit app, double-check that mobile deep-links still route to the recovery screen and not the old Lanternbrook onboarding flow. Tap a test link on both platforms, confirm the routing table version matches the ceremony sheet, and note it in the log. Once both witnesses initial the entry, you'll unlock the sealed envelope using the passphrase printed directly below this line.

unlock words, hahip-baduf: holwyn-istath-julvan

Quick note for the sync: the Coinfold conversion API rounds at the final step, not per line item, which is why totals occasionally differ from naive client-side math by a cent. If you sum converted line items yourself, expect drift — use the /v3/convert/batch endpoint instead, which applies banker's rounding to the aggregate. The sandbox mirrors production rounding exactly, so test there before filing bugs. Sandbox requests must be authenticated; use the bearer token below.

session JWT of yawep-yawep = eyJhbGciOiJIUzI1NiIsInR5cCI6IkpXVCJ9.eyJzdWIiOiI3pWF3_In0.aXYsHiog

## Configuration

KestrelHook retries failed webhook deliveries with exponential backoff. Set WEBHOOK_MAX_ATTEMPTS (default 5) and WEBHOOK_BACKOFF_BASE_MS (default 2000). A 410 response disables the endpoint; anything else in the 4xx range is not retried. Delivery receipts go to the audit topic. Each outbound request is HMAC-signed, and the signing key must be set on the line that follows.

secret setting of hawep-yahig: LEDGER_TOKEN29=41b5d6315371c92885eaeb077fb63

**FAQ: Why did my schema change get blocked by Corvid Registry?**

The Corvid event schema registry enforces backward compatibility on all production topics. If your review includes a field removal or type change, the registry rejects registration and CI fails. Reviewers should request an additive change or a new versioned subject instead. Overrides require unsealing the registry admin keystore, which is done by entering the recovery passphrase shown below.

strongbox words: norwyn-wenael-aldvan-aldiel-wendor-holael